Arguably the versions on Final V.U. from St David's University, Wales 6 Dec 1972 and Oliver's, Boston 27 May 1973, after Moe's departure could count as Doug Yule solo efforts - although the sound quality on both is poor.

But then, I guess, the extent to which Doug had a solo career beyond this was limited to little more than a CD of a live performance in Seattle in 2000, and "Squeeze".
